Está en la página 1de 12

Facultad de Ingeniería, Departamento de Mecánica y Mecátronica

Universidad Nacional de Colombia - Sede Bogotá

PROGRAMACIÓN MANUAL CENTRO


DE MAQUINADO VERTICAL
Planeado

José Manuel Arroyo Osorio, José Luis Pineda Salinas


Contenido
1

Lista de códigos G

Lista de códigos M

Encabezado de un programa
¿Cómo llevar a HOME la máquina?

Funciones para planeado


G00
G01

Problema propuesto

Procesos de Manufactura II | CNC


Códigos G
2

Código Aplicación
*G00 Movimiento rápido de la herramienta en vacío
*G01 Movimiento lineal con avance programado
G02 Movimiento circular con avance programado en sentido a las manecillas del reloj
G03 Movimiento circular con avance programado en sentido contrario a las manecillas del reloj
*G17 Selección del plano XY
G18 Selección del plano ZX
G19 Selección del plano YZ
G28 Retorno a posición de referencia ’{Home}’
*G40 Cancela la compensación de diámetro
G41 Compensación de diámetro a la izquierda
G42 Compensación de diámetro a la derecha
G43 Compensación de longitud en dirección positiva
G44 Compensación de longitud en dirección negativa
*G49 Cancela la compensación de longitud
*G54∼G59 Sistemas coordenados de trabajo

Procesos de Manufactura II | CNC


Códigos G
3

Código Aplicación
*G80 Cancelación de ciclos
G81 Ciclo de taladrado sin retroceso
G82 Ciclo de taladrado con permanencia en el fondo
G83 Ciclo de taladrado profundo
G84 Ciclo de roscado
G85 Ciclo de escariado
*G90 Comando de referencia absoluto
*G91 Comando de referencia incremental
G92 Establece el sistema de coordenadas de trabajo o la máxima velocidad del husillo (r/min)
*G98 Retorno al punto inicial antes de iniciar el ciclo fijado
G99 Retorno al punto de referencia después de inicial el ciclo fijado

Procesos de Manufactura II | CNC


Códigos M
4

Código Función
M00 Parada no opcional
M01 Parada opcional
M03 Encender husillo en sentido a las manecillas del reloj (CW)
M04 Encender husillo en sentido contrario a las manecillas del reloj (CW)
M05 Detener la rotación el husillo
M06 Cambio de herramienta
M08 Activar fluido de corte en chorro
M09 Detener el fluido de corte
M30 Fin de programa
M58 Activar el fluido de corte interno a alta presión
M98 Llamar subprograma
M99 Volver al programa principal desde un subprograma

Procesos de Manufactura II | CNC


Encabezado de un programa
Parámetros iniciales 5

Este debe ir al inicio de todo programa, allí se eliminan estados guar-


dados anteriormente en la máquina tales como compensaciones, ci-
clos, entre otros.
Las estructuras pueden ser la siguientes:
I G90 G20 G80 G40 G49
I G90 G21 G80 G40 G49
I G91 G20 G80 G40 G49
I G91 G21 G80 G40 G49
La diferencia principal consiste el que unidades se trabajará, así como
el sistema de referencia para las medidas de la pieza (incremental o
absoluto).

Procesos de Manufactura II | CNC


Encabezado de un programa
¿Cómo llevar a HOME la máquina?
6

Después de definir el encabezado, es preciso que se lleve la máquina


a su sistema de referencia principal HOME, con el fin de que evitar
algún tipo de incidente. Para ello se usará el siguiente bloque:
I Para sistema absoluto G91 G28 Z0;
I Para sistema incremental seguirá una estructura similar con dos
diferencias fundamentales se sustituye G91 por G90 y el valor
de Z dependerá de la posición de la herramienta

Procesos de Manufactura II | CNC


Encabezado de un programa
¿Cómo llevar a HOME la máquina?
7

Una vez se tenga se garantiza la posición en Z libre de obstaculos, se


llevará a HOME en los ejes restantes de la siguiente manera:

I Para sistema incremental G91 G28 X100 Y150;


I Para sistema absoluto G90 G28 X0 Y0;

Procesos de Manufactura II | CNC


Posicionamiento rápido transversal
G00 8

Esta función tiene como objetivo la reubicación de la herramienta des-


de un punto A a un punto B a lo largo de una trayectoria recta y la más
rápida posible.
El operador deberá estar pendiente de que el camino de la herramien-
ta esté libre de obstáculos para evitar colisiones que dañen la pieza y
la máquina.
Se recomienda realizar estos movimientos a una distancia Z de 1 in
medidos desde la superficie, para efectos de este curso se recomien-
da que se ubique esta distancia a 50mm, para efectos gráficos estos
movimientos se representan con una linea recta punteada.

Procesos de Manufactura II | CNC


Interpolación lineal
G01 9

Es usada para mover la herramienta desde el punto P1 a P2 a lo largo


de uno o todos los ejes simultáneamente, a diferencia de G00, este
código pide ingresar un código F ya que el objetivo principal consiste
en la remoción de material de la pieza, en los planos de manufactura
se denota con una línea continua.
Ejemplo: G01 X3 Y1 F8

Procesos de Manufactura II | CNC


Problema propuesto
10

Procesos de Manufactura II | CNC


Problema propuesto
11

Procesos de Manufactura II | CNC

También podría gustarte